Have you ever thought that the skin is more than just the body’s protective layer and probiotic can improve that? In reality, it is also home to millions of microorganisms. On the surface of our skin lives a diverse community known as the skin microbiome, made up of various bacteria, fungi, and other microbes.
When kept in balance, these microorganisms act like the skin’s natural guardians (probiotics), helping defend against harmful pathogens while maintaining the skin’s protective barrier. Unfortunately, this balance does not always stay intact.
When the number or types of microorganisms on the skin change a condition known as dysbiosis the skin’s protective function can become disrupted. As a result, the skin may become more vulnerable to inflammation and infection.
This imbalance is often linked to a range of common skin problems, including acne, atopic dermatitis, psoriasis, and rosacea. As scientists continue to learn more about the skin microbiome, the way we think about skincare is beginning to shift.
In the past, skincare largely focused on eliminating microorganisms from the skin. Today, the conversation is moving toward maintaining a healthy balance within the skin’s ecosystem.
This is where probiotics or also called health boosting microorganism are gaining attention. Rather than simply targeting microbes, probiotics offer a promising approach by helping restore microbial balance and supporting overall skin health in a more holistic way.

Getting to Know Probiotics in Skin Health
In recent years, scientists have become increasingly interested in exploring the relationship between the gut and the skin often referred to as the gut skin axis in various skin disorders. This connection highlights how important it is to maintain a balanced microbiome within the body.
One approach that has gained attention is the use of health boosting microorganism, commonly described as good bacteria that help restore and maintain the body’s natural microbial balance. Today, the use of probiotics in skincare is growing rapidly.
Scientific literature on the topic continues to expand, reflecting how health boosting microorganism are becoming an increasingly important area of research in modern dermatology. For example, several species of Lactobacillus have been widely used as health boosting microorganism, both in topical applications and oral supplements, to support skin health.
These beneficial bacteria can now be found in a variety of products, including creams, lotions, serums, and dietary supplements. Health boosting microorganism are believed to help calm inflammation while also restoring balance to the skin microbiome.
A number of skin conditions have been reported to potentially benefit from probiotic use, including acne, atopic dermatitis, rosacea, sensitive skin, and even early signs of skin aging. Through these mechanisms, probiotics may support healthier skin by helping maintain the natural balance of microorganisms living on its surface.
This growing use of probiotics highlights an important point: probiotics do not work only in the digestive system. They may also produce direct biological effects on the skin.
The Role of Probiotics in Managing Common Skin Problems
Topical probiotics are increasingly being explored as a new approach to managing a variety of skin problems. Studies conducted in both humans and animal models suggest that probiotics may help maintain the balance of the skin microbiome while also reducing inflammatory processes in the skin.
In acne prone skin, for instance, the composition of the skin microbiome often differs from that of healthy skin. Conventional acne treatments can sometimes leave the skin dry and irritated because they may disrupt the skin’s protective barrier.
Topical probiotics may help support the repair of the skin barrier while also stimulating the production of antimicrobial peptides. One example involves lactic acid produced by Streptococcus thermophilus.
As a health boosting microorganism component, it can stimulate ceramide production, which helps maintain skin moisture while also inhibiting the growth of Cutibacterium acnes, a bacterium associated with acne development. By supporting these mechanisms, probiotics may help keep the skin healthier and less prone to breakouts.
Atopic dermatitis is also closely linked to an imbalance in the skin microbiome, often accompanied by increased colonization of pathogenic bacteria such as Staphylococcus aureus. Certain health boosting microorganism species, including Lactobacillus sakei and Lactobacillus johnsonii, have been shown to inhibit the growth of S. aureus.

Other Benefits of Probiotics for Skin Problems
Some studies indicate that topical probiotics such as Vitreoscilla filiformis may help reduce redness, flaking, and itching. In addition, scalp issues like dandruff may also improve through the oral use of probiotics such as Lactobacillus paracasei.
When the skin is injured, the composition of the microbiome can change, increasing the risk of infection. Several animal studies have shown that health boosting microorganism such as Lactiplantibacillus plantarum, Lactobacillus fermentum, Saccharomyces cerevisiae, and microorganisms found in kefir may help accelerate wound healing.
They appear to support the formation of granulation tissue, improve collagen deposition, and stimulate angiogenesis. Health boosting microorganism may also help inhibit the formation of bacterial biofilms, which can otherwise slow down the healing process.
The potential of topical health boosting microorganism is also being explored in the context of skin aging and photoaging. Some studies suggest that probiotics may help reduce oxidative stress, improve the function of the skin barrier, and contribute to visible skin improvements such as reduced wrinkles and hyperpigmentation.
